The French Dispatch: La Vie Littéraire
Unit photography by Roger Do Minh. Courtesy of Fox Searchlight Pictures. The eighth collaboration between director Wes Anderson and cinematographer Robert Yeoman, ASC, The French Dispatch is the latest step in a creative evolution that began in 1996 with the feature Bottle Rocket. The teaming yields increasingly ambitious results with each new outing, and their latest is presented as a series of magazine articles from the titular publication, brought to life onscreen. The story begins with the death of the fictional magazine’s editor, Arthur Howitzer Jr. (Bill Murray), whose passing inspires recollections of highlights from Dispatch history.
